一、v2ray和v2rayn的介绍
1. v2ray
v2ray是一个开源的网络代理软件,可以实现多种协议和加密方式,支持TCP、mKCP、WebSocket、HTTP/2等传输协议,并且具有流量伪装、数据加密等功能。由于其强大的隐蔽性和高效性,在科学上网领域得到了广泛应用。
2. v2rayn
v2rayn是一款基于v2ray的图形化客户端,是v2ray的一个衍生品,也是免费的开源软件。v2rayn不仅支持v2ray的全部功能,还提供了一些便捷的操作方式,如快速更换节点、管理订阅等。
二、v2ray和v2rayn的区别
在使用上,v2ray和v2rayn都可以实现科学上网,但是它们也有一些明显的区别:
| 区别 | v2ray | v2rayn | | —- | —- | —- | | 运行方式 | 命令行 | 图形化界面 | | 使用难度 | 需要一定的命令行基础 | 操作相对简单 | | 配置方式 | 需要手动编辑配置文件 | 支持图形化配置 | | 功能特点 | 拥有更强大的隐蔽性和自定义性 | 操作更加方便,支持管理订阅 |
三、v2ray和v2rayn的安装和使用教程
1. v2ray的安装和使用教程
安装v2ray
-
Linux/macOS系统:
- 打开终端,输入以下命令:
bash <(curl -L -s https://install.direct/go.sh)
- 安装完成后,会生成一个默认配置文件config.json,需要手动编辑进行配置。
-
Windows系统:
- 下载最新的v2ray-windows-64.zip压缩包,并解压。
- 在v2ray.exe所在的目录下,新建一个config.json文件,并进行配置。
使用v2ray
-
命令行方式: 在终端输入v2ray即可。
-
作为系统代理:
- 打开系统代理设置,将代理类型设置为SOCKS5,并将地址和端口填写为v2ray的监听地址和端口。
- 需要注意的是,使用SOCKS5代理时,DNS解析需要单独进行配置。
2. v2rayn的安装和使用教程
安装v2rayn
- Windows系统:
- 下载v2rayn.zip压缩包,并解压到任意位置。
- 运行v2rayN.exe,会自动生成一个config.json配置文件,可以进行进一步的配置。
使用v2rayn
-
订阅节点:
- 在服务器上生成一个订阅链接,并将其添加到v2rayn中。
- 在v2rayn中选择需要使用的节点即可。
-
手动添加节点:
- 在v2rayn中手动添加一个节点,并进行相关配置。
四、常见问题解答
1. v2ray和v2rayn哪个更好用?
这个问题很难回答,因为它们都有各自的优缺点,选择哪个取决于你的个人喜好和需求。如果你更注重隐蔽性和自定义性,那么建议选择v2ray;如果你更注重操作的便捷性,那么v2rayn可能更适合你。
2. v2ray和v2rayn的配置文件格式是什么?
v2ray和v2rayn的配置文件都是JSON格式的。
3. v2ray和v2rayn都支持哪些传输协议?
v2ray和v2rayn都支持TCP、mKCP、WebSocket、HTTP/2等传输协议。
4. v2ray和v2rayn都支持哪些加密方式?
v2ray和v2rayn都支持TLS、AES、Chacha20等多种加密方式。
5. v2ray和v2rayn有没有GUI客户端?
v2ray没有GUI客户端,需要通过命令行或其他第三方客户端使用;而v2rayn提供了图形化界面,操作更加方便。
6. v2ray和v2rayn都支持哪些操作系统?
v2ray和v2rayn都支持Windows、Linux和macOS等主流操作系统。
7. v2ray和v2rayn都需要开启什么服务?
v2ray和v2rayn都需要开启v2ray服务。
8. v2ray和v2rayn都支持哪些平台?
v2ray和v2rayn都支持PC和移动端的Windows、Linux和macOS系统。